Bass drums usually are built from an individual bit of tree trunk, generally mango or cedar, which is hollowed out by possibly lathe or hand. More mature, larger sized drums ended up made from the dense but gentle pounds cottonwood tree which is rarely located now. Some bass drum shells are made of maple ply-wood, Other individuals Use a barrel stave design. The drum shell is roofed on either side by goat skins which are pulled tightly with rope. Different amounts of "massala", a proprietary thick, sticky, tar-like concoction, is positioned within the insides from the skin to create a reduced frequency resonation within the "bass" side hit using a stick, and a greater frequency resonation on the more "treble" facet strike with the hand.

Certainly one of the most important rituals all through this time would be the darshan (viewing) from the idol. Devotees stand in very long queues, often for over 24 hours, just to acquire a glimpse of Lalbaugcha Raja. There's two principal queues for darshan: the “Navsachi Line,” in which devotees seek blessings for their wishes to generally be fulfilled, as well as the “Mukh Darshan Line,” which happens to be for basic viewing.

The North Indian dhol-tasha drumming custom was distribute globally by the British indenture-ship method, which started during the 1830s and sent countless Guys, Girls, and kids to work in agricultural and industrial colonies throughout the world. While distinctive dhol-tasha variants emerged in several destinations wherever indentured laborers settled, the most vibrant of such is tassa drumming during the southern Caribbean place of Trinidad and Tobago.
